Tackling Sewer Line Repairs: Techniques, Costs & Expectations
Sewer line issues can be a homeowner's worst challenge. When your sewer system starts failing, it can lead to costly situations. Fortunately, experts have several proven techniques to repair sewer lines and restore your home's functionality.
Open-cut methods involve digging a trench to reach the damaged section of pipe. This is a standard method for major repairs, but it can be invasive to your yard.
Pipe Bursting methods offer a neighborly alternative. These techniques use specialized machinery to repair the pipe without extensive digging. A small trench is all that's needed, minimizing disruption to your land.
The expense of sewer line repairs can range significantly depending on the magnitude of the damage, the technique used, and the location of the problem. Factors like soil conditions can also affect the price tag.
Ahead of deciding on a repair method, it's essential to consult a certified professional. They can evaluate your sewer line, pinpoint the problem, and provide you with an accurate cost breakdown for the repair.
Remember that preventative attention can help extend the lifelong of your sewer line and avoid costly repairs down the road.

Facing Budget Bombs: Understanding Sewer Pipe Repair Costs
Sewer pipe repair costs can be a major financial obstacle. The price tag often depends on variables like the extent of the damage, and What to Expect the difficulty of the repair, and the site of the issue. A subtle leak might only require a straightforward patch, while a major break could necessitate renovating entire sections of pipe. To avoid sudden expenses, it's essential to understand the potential costs involved before diving into any repairs.
- Request multiple quotes from certified plumbers to compare prices and services offered.
- Evaluate preventative care measures to reduce the risk of costly repairs in the future.
Stay ready with monetary resources to handle potential repair costs.
